How To Fix CA_AS_ESH009 -


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: CA_AS_ESH - message class for search model browser

  • Message number: 009

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message CA_AS_ESH009 - ?

    The SAP error message CA_AS_ESH009 typically relates to issues encountered in the SAP Enterprise Search (EHS) or the SAP Application Server (AS) when trying to access or utilize the Enterprise Search functionality. This error can arise due to various reasons, including configuration issues, missing components, or problems with the underlying data.

    Cause:

    1. Configuration Issues: The search configuration may not be set up correctly, leading to the error.
    2. Missing Index: The search index may not be created or updated, which is necessary for the search functionality to work.
    3. Authorization Problems: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to access the search functionality.
    4. Data Issues: There may be issues with the data being indexed or searched, such as missing or corrupted data.
    5. System Performance: High load on the system or performance issues can also lead to this error.

    Solution:

    1. Check Configuration: Review the configuration settings for the Enterprise Search. Ensure that all necessary components are correctly configured.
    2. Rebuild Index: If the index is missing or outdated, you may need to rebuild it. This can usually be done through the SAP GUI or relevant transaction codes.
    3. Review Authorizations: Ensure that the user has the necessary authorizations to perform the search. Check the roles and profiles assigned to the user.
    4. Data Validation: Validate the data being indexed. Ensure that there are no inconsistencies or corruption in the data.
    5. System Monitoring: Monitor system performance and check for any bottlenecks or issues that may be affecting the search functionality.
    6. Check Logs: Review the application logs for any additional error messages or warnings that may provide more context about the issue.
